1、模块1,HighLight过程,高亮显示:Public LastRange As Range ' 用于存储上次突出显示的区域Public currCell As RangeSub HighLight() On Error Resume Next Dim dataRange As Range Dim currRange As Range Dim lastRow As Long Dim lastCol As Long '获取工作表的数据区域,这里假设数据...
1、模块1,HighLight过程,高亮显示:Public LastRange As Range ' 用于存储上次突出显示的区域Public currCell As RangePublic Dic As ObjectPublic blnHighLight As BooleanSub HighLight() On Error Resume Next Dim dataRange As Range Dim currRange As Range Dim lastRow As Long Dim lastCol...
1、模块1,HighLight过程,高亮显示: Public LastRange As Range ' 用于存储上次突出显示的区域 Public currCell As Range Sub HighLight() On Error Resume Next Dim dataRange As Range Dim currRange As Range Dim lastRow As Long Dim lastCol As Long '获取工作表的数据区域,这里假设数据区域从A1开始,向右...
VBA Code to Highlight Blank Cell Conclusion Related Tutorials It’s hard to recognize blank cells in large data because a blank cell is just a white cell without any value. In most cases, blank cells represent some sort of gap missing data, or a formula returns an empty string resulting i...
在Excel中,可以使用VBA编写代码来实现颜色突出显示具有相同值的单元格。以下是一个示例代码: 代码语言:txt 复制 Sub HighlightDuplicateCells() Dim rng As Range Dim cell As Range Dim dict As Object Set dict = CreateObject("Scripting.Dictionary") Set rng = ActiveSheet.UsedRange For Each cell In...
' Highlight the active cell Target.Interior.ColorIndex = 36 Application.ScreenUpdating = True End Sub 2. 高亮选中单元格所在的行和列。 Private Sub Worksheet_SelectionChange(ByVal Target As Range) If Target.Cells.Count > 1 Then Exit Sub ...
1. 转到“开发者”选项卡 -> “Visual Basic” -> 打开VBA编辑器。2. 插入一个模块 -> 编写以下代码: Sub HighlightCells() Dim rng As Range Set rng = Application.InputBox("请选择一个范围:", Type:=8) rng.Select With Selection .FormatConditions.Delete .FormatConditions.Ad...
1. 当工作表选择区域发生变化时,自动更新`currCell`为当前选中的第一个单元格,并调用`HighLight`过程进行高亮显示。2. 当工作表变为非激活状态时,清除上次的高亮格式,以适应工作表切换场景。3. 在工作表关闭前事件中,清除高亮格式并保存工作表,确保数据完整性。通过上述VBA代码实现,用户在Excel中...
使用下面的代码突出显示其中包含注释的所有单元格。 Sub HighlightCellsWithComments() ActiveSheet.Cells.SpecialCells(xlCellTypeComments).Interior.Color = vbBlue End Sub 在本例中,使用vblue为单元格赋予蓝色。如果你想的话,你可以把这个换成其他颜色。
另一种方法是使用VBA宏来实现高亮显示功能。用户可以通过编写一段简单的VBA代码来捕获选中单元格的行号和列号,并据此设置高亮显示。具体来说,可以在VBA编辑器中创建一个新的模块,并输入类似以下的代码:`Sub Highlight_Row_Column Dim rng As Range Set rng = Selection Rows.Interior.ColorIndex = ...